Love, sex and death – inside one woman’s head. This darkly funny solo show follows a middle-aged woman who doesn’t quite fit, arguing with her own unconscious about how to live. As libido and mortality interrupt her thoughts, she uses sharp humour to open a playful and revealing exploration of identity, desire and grief. Blending text, movement and flamenco-inspired dance, the piece shifts from comedy into a more physical and poetic space. Intimate, bold and unfiltered, it invites audiences into the inner voices we carry but rarely dare to speak aloud.
